It's just as easy to learn to play righty, and many lefties do exactly that. In fact, if anything fretting is more challenging than strumming so to some extent you would have an advantage. Both of your hands have a job to do so it really doesn't matter if you learn righty. That has the advantages of a much larger selection of guitars available to you and a large selection of teaching material, virtually all of which is designed for righties. Good luck.

This is a right handed world. It wasn't my idea, but that is the way it is. I am sure you do many things right handed and you have survived.
Something that most players do not think about. Artist and Musician are frequently left handed. It is thought by many that the string instruments were designed originally by lefties because the left hand does all the fingering work.
If you get into Brass instruments the left hand just holds the instrument and the right does the fingering.
Woodwinds, Keyboard and a few others use both.
Unless you are extremely proud of being a Lefty, get a regular guitar. One that you can share with others, and you will be able to try out theirs. This can be a big advantage when upgrading, which we all do a lot.
